Rico Rally – Alpine Adventure

Experience Europe’s most spectacular driving roads in one unforgettable week – from the Black Forest to the high Alpine passes of Switzerland, Italy and Austria, before returning through Germany for a final night celebration in Belgium.

Day 1: From the Tunnel to the Black ForestThe Rico Rally cars line up for a photo shoot at the legendary Reims-Gueux race circuit

Our adventure begins with an early Eurotunnel crossing into France before heading south through Champagne country, calling at the historic Reims-Gueux Grand Prix circuit for a quick stop and photo opportunity.

From here, the journey continues across the Rhine and into Germany’s Black Forest region.

By early evening we’ll arrive at our first hotel in Freiburg, where a welcome dinner sets the tone for the week ahead – great food, great company, and plenty of driving tales already starting to form.

Day 2: The Three Giants

An aerial view of the Furka pass, Belvedere hotel and glacierToday the adventure properly begins as we leave Freiburg and head straight into the legendary Black Forest on some of Europe’s best stretches of driving tarmac.

Rico Rally on an empty Grimsel pass in SwitzerlandCrossing into Switzerland, the landscape rises dramatically and the mountains start to dominate the skyline. The afternoon brings a trio of icons: the Susten, Grimsel and Furka passes – three of the greats, often featured together in the world’s best driving routes.

From the sweeping views on the Susten, to the glacier-lined switchbacks of the Furka, every climb and descent offers something special.

By late afternoon, we roll into the Alpine village of Andermatt, where our hotel and an evening of relaxation await.

Day 3: The Heart of Switzerland

An elevated view of the Lukmanier pass and lake with snow-capped peaks in the backgroundLeaving Andermatt behind, we dive straight into a day packed with variety and elevation.

A blue Subaru enjoys the open road of the San Bernardino passThe Lukmanier Pass sets the tone – long, smooth and beautifully scenic – before the route climbs higher onto the San Bernardino, where broad hairpins and open vistas invite a rhythm that’s pure driving pleasure.

The road then tightens and twists over the Splügen Pass, tracing the Italian border, before opening out again onto the graceful Maloja. Every mile delivers a new view – mountain lakes, tumbling waterfalls, and snow-capped peaks in every direction.

The final ascent of the Julier Pass brings a broad, sweeping finish to the day, descending into Davos, our next stop. Expect crisp mountain air and a premium hotel ready for a well-earned evening of comfort and good food.

Day 4: The Alpine Loop

Photo of an epic curve on the fabulous Fluela pass with Rico RallyAfter a couple of big driving days, we take a slightly gentler pace today and enjoying the incredible alpine scenery that surrounds us.

The sweeping west descent of Stelvio pass towards Bormio with a mountain river in the foregroundFrom Davos we head across the Flüela Pass before making our way toward the Umbrail Pass, a stunning ascent that joins the Stelvio route just below the summit – offering dramatic views without the full 48-hairpin climb.

We make the sweeping descent into Bormio, then enjoy a scenic run over the Livigno, Bernina and Albula passes, completing a satisfying loop of the eastern Swiss Alps before returning to Davos for a second night.

Day 5: Austrian Passes & Alpine Valleys

Rico Rally on an empty Hahntennjoch pass in Austria Today we head for Austria – a country made for drivers. The route climbs through wide alpine meadows and forested slopes toward the spectacular Hahntennjoch Pass, a twisting masterpiece that rewards smooth, confident driving with breathtaking views from its summit.

An empty straight road in the Namlos valleyDropping into the Namlos Valley, the pace eases and the scenery softens – a quiet, hidden stretch where small villages and winding lanes give a glimpse of rural alpine life. From here, we follow sections of the German Alpine Road, a picture-postcard landscape of lakes and mountains.

It’s a perfectly balanced day – exciting roads in the morning, relaxing drives in the afternoon – before crossing back into Switzerland and on to St Gallen for our overnight stay. The hotel here offers an incredible water complex for a chance to unwind after another exceptional day behind the wheel.

Day 6: Black Forest Finale

An autumnal image of a black forest road with the sun low in the sky shining through the treesThe penultimate day sees us return through the Black Forest’s flowing curves and open valleys, enjoying one last run through Germany before crossing into Belgium for our final night hotel.

Here we’ll gather for a celebration dinner, raising a glass to an incredible week of driving through some of Europe’s best roads and scenery.

Day 7: Homeward Bound

After breakfast, we make our way back through the Ardennes to Calais for our return to the UK – tired but smiling, with a week of unforgettable memories and a camera full of mountain views.
